Common Beam Repair Service Jobs
Beam repair involves fixing damaged or weakened structural supports to ensure stability.
Beam replacement addresses severely compromised beams that require full removal and installation of new ones.
Sagging beam repair corrects uneven or drooping beams to restore proper load distribution.
Rot and termite damage repair targets wood decay caused by pests or moisture, preventing further deterioration.
Beam reinforcement involves adding support elements to strengthen existing beams without full replacement.
Custom beam repair solutions are tailored to specific structural needs for safe and effective restoration.
Beam Repair Service Questions
What types of beams can be repaired? Beam repair services typically address wood, steel, or concrete beams that have experienced damage or deterioration.
When is beam repair necessary? Repair is needed when beams show signs of sagging, cracking, rot, rust, or other structural issues affecting stability.
What are common causes of beam damage? Damage often results from moisture exposure, pests, heavy loads, or age-related wear and tear.
How can I tell if a beam needs repair? Visible cracks, sagging floors, or unusual noises are indicators that a beam may require inspection and repair.
